We invite you to participate in the inaugural ESGO Survey on Environmental Sustainability. The World Health Organization defines environmental sustainability in healthcare as ‘a strategy to improve, maintain or restore health, while minimizing negative impacts on the environment and leveraging opportunities to restore and improve it, to the benefit of the health and well-being of current and future generations. This survey aims to investigate your attitudes, expectations, awareness and commitment regarding environmental sustainability in your clinical work as well as to capture how members advice ESGO and IGCS to support environmental sustainability in their activities.

Your insights are invaluable in shaping future initiatives and policies to promote sustainable practices in gynaecologic oncology. The results of the survey are planned to be published and discussed further during the next ESGO congress.
